In a deeply moving social media announcement, television personality Calum Best has revealed his mother, Angie Best, has been diagnosed with cancer.

An Emotional Public Announcement

Calum Best, the son of football legend George Best and his first wife Angie, posted a tearful video to his Instagram account on Thursday, 8 January 2026. In the candid clip, he shared the devastating news that his 73-year-old mother is battling colon cancer.

The cancer was diagnosed a few weeks ago and has unfortunately spread to her liver, Calum explained. He described the difficulty of finding the right words before deciding that honesty was the only path forward when discussing his mother's health.

A Life Dedicated to Health and Wellness

Calum painted a picture of his mother as a woman who has always prioritised her wellbeing. "For as long as I can remember, she has lived her life rooted in health, fitness and wellbeing," he said. "She has always believed in taking care of the body, mind and soul."

This background makes the diagnosis particularly cruel, highlighting a painful reality. Calum emphasised that cancer does not discriminate, regardless of lifestyle, background, or efforts to maintain good health.

The announcement has drawn an outpouring of support from fans and friends of the Best family. Angie, married to George Best from 1978 to 1986, has largely stayed out of the public eye in recent years.

Calum's decision to share the news publicly underscores the profound impact the diagnosis has had on the family. His emotional video serves as a stark reminder of the indiscriminate nature of the disease, affecting even those who have championed healthy living.

The family now faces the challenging journey ahead as Angie begins her treatment. No further details regarding her prognosis or specific treatment plans have been disclosed at this time.
